It did not forgive us when the East India Company used Tamil soldiers for crushing the anti British resistance movement in South India. 73 Carnatic Infantry was raised in Thiruchirappalli entirely with Tamil people in 1776. In 1799 this unit, rechristened as 2nd Battalion of the 3rd Madras Native Infantry was part of a force which captured the Srirangapatna Fort. Under the orders of Governor General Richard Wellesley every one found inside the Fort was put to the sword and Srirangapatna town was plundered.

This event was not regretted for by the Tamil society and as a consequence India was brought to its knees and suffered the ignominy of being slaves of the British for the next 150 years.

The same unit, now as 2nd Battalion the Madras Regiment led the attack against Tamils in Srilanka. They decimated the unarmed and lightly armed Tamil population between 1987 and 90 and set the stage for the mass genocide of the Tamils by the Srilankan Army in 2009.
